Q: Does this scooter have a suspension system?
A: Yes, it features a dual-tube suspension with a maximum stroke of 1.26 inches (32mm) for a smoother ride.
Q: How powerful is the motor on this electric scooter?
A: The scooter has a 350W brushless motor that provides a maximum power output of 700W.
Q: What type of braking system does the scooter have?
A: The KQi 200P has front and rear dual-action disc brakes, along with regenerative braking.
Q: How far can I travel on a single charge with this scooter?
A: You can travel up to 33.6 miles (54 km) on a single charge.
Q: What is the warranty period for the KQi 200P?
A: The KQi 200P comes with a comprehensive 2-year warranty covering accessories and consumable parts.

The NIU 200P KQI scooter is a great scooter for commuters or students, or for those just looking to get around. The build quality is very impressive and durable for daily use. I have no doubt this scooter will last a long time. The scooter comes pretty much assembled, other than a few screws and 10 minutes of your time. A full charge takes about 5 hours. Depending on your weight, real world distance for someone like me at 170lbs is around 25 miles or so between charges. The acceleration is very nice at full battery, but slows with less battery. I’m sure this is to save power. The scooter slows exponentially when under 10 percent battery left as do all scooters. The lighting on the scooter is very bright, headlight and brake lights are perfect for safety, day or night. The scooter breaks down very easily with a button in the lower handlebar, and folds and locks so it can be carried (about 40 lbs.) and put into a hatch or trunk. I was able to put mine in a Ford focus without issue. The handle bar has a small bell ringer on the left/brake side. The right side has turn signal controls. The light on each side for the signal is bright and tone alert loud. I loaned mine to my daughter, who is a college student. Now she wants one. It was much better than her current scooter. The handle bar has a nice hook that can be used to attach a lock. As I previously mentioned, the acceleration is very nice. The torque when taking off, or just increasing your speed when needed is instantaneous. The rear 700W motor is more than enough for this unit. The brakes are nice and are not grabby or extremely sensitive. It won’t throw you over the handle bars when full brake is applied. The rear brake is a regenerative brake. This happens when you let off the accelerator as the unit slows down, the battery receives a small charge. The tubeless tires are just right for this size of scooter. They along with the dual front shocks offer great stability when addressing rough roads or bumps. The deck is just perfect for my 9.5 size shoes but may be an issue with those who have larger feet. The app is great for this unit. I had my daughter try to pair her phone with the scooter after my phone was paired. She was unable to pair unless she would send in proof of purchase to the manufacture in order to pair it. I love this as not everyone can pair it and take off with it. Speaking of the app, it shows battery strength percentage, miles traveled, any faults, and location (only if you and scooter are in same location). You can tweak the settings to show mph or km. Also record your rides to show distance and speed. Daytime running light can be turned on or off, or turn both daytime and night light on. For security you can set alarm, and if the bike is moved 1 foot, the alarm and lights flash until turned off in app. The location of the bike and you are tracked if you turn on locations. But does not track scooter if it is stolen. You might find a conspicuous area for a “tag” if you require this, which is a great idea. The handle bar has a small bell ringer on the left/brake side. The right side has turn signal controls. The light on each side for the signal is bright and tone alert loud. I would recommend this to friends and family.

Summary: The NIU - Kqi 200P is great full featured electric scooter that is fun to use. Setup: The scooter comes well secured and is almost fully assembled. The box (and scooter itself) is a little heavier than I expected, so you may want some help with a second person to unbox. After removing the scooter from the box you need to attach and secure the handlebars to the base using the enclosed hex bolts. Before using the scooter, I fully charged it overnight. NIU App: After downloading the NIU app and creating an account, you will connect the scooter via a Bluetooth connection. Once connected, you can customize some of the settings of the scooter. This includes Start Speed: How fast you need to manually push the scooter before the motor can activate, Regeneration breaking: how much the scooter will slow down if the accelerator is not active, and Dynamic Mode: acceleration characteristics. There is also a way to lock and unlock the scooter. Riding experience: This was my first experience with an eclectic scooter, so I had a little bit of a learning curve on the first few attempts to ride. However, after a few tries I was able to get a hang of how to properly stand and balance on it. I like the scooter needs to be moving at a min speed before the motor kicks in, to ensure it doesn’t accidently turn on. I do like that the scooter has shocks on it. It made for a smooth ride going over speed humps and cracks in sidewalks. One note is that I do think they should have some kind of safety string that will shut off the motor in case you step off the scooter and don’t let off the accelerator. Storage: The scooter can conveniently fold down to make it easier for storage and transport. You just need to be aware that the scooter is on the heavier side and may be difficult for some to pick up and carry.
